sqemo-mcp
MCP server for Sqemo — AI agents that follow your team's database naming standard.
Your agent models in business terms ("Customer Number"); the column comes out as cust_no
because your word list says customer → cust, number → no (case and delimiter are rules
too, so CUST_NO is one setting away). Same input, same name, every
table, every agent. Overrides are allowed but flagged, and a CLI lint catches drift in CI.

What it looks like
Model a discussion board where members post articles, a post can be a reply to another post, and members comment on posts.
The agent calls the tools with logical names and never types a column name:
upsert_entity { logicalName: "Post" }
// → { physicalName: "POST" }
upsert_attribute { logicalName: "Post Content", domain: "Content" }
// → { physicalName: "POST_CNTS" } // Content → CNTS: from the team word list
upsert_attribute { logicalName: "Delete Flag", domain: "Flag" }
// → { physicalName: "DELETE_YN" } // Flag → YN: same rule in every table
lint_erd
// → naming drift, missing words, referential integrity — before any DDL is written
CNTS and YN are not the agent's taste. They are your word list's abbreviations, applied the
same way they were applied in every other table your team has modelled. Domains carry the data
type, so Content is varchar(1000) everywhere it appears.

Overview
AI agents can query and edit entities, relationships, and domains; generate physical names
from a shared team glossary; import/export SQL (7 dialects) and DBML; and compare the model
against a live database. Works with both local .erd.json files and ERDs stored on the
Sqemo cloud.

Login (cloud ERDs and Pro tools)
npx sqemo-mcp login # pick Google, GitHub, or email + password
npx sqemo-mcp logout # removes stored credentials
login asks how you want to sign in. Google and GitHub open a browser tab, complete a
PKCE OAuth flow, and hand the session back through a one-shot loopback server on
127.0.0.1; the third option takes an email and password in the terminal. Only a
refresh token is ever stored.
- Credentials are stored in
~/.erdmaker/credentials.json(mode 0600 on POSIX); your password is never persisted. - Non-interactive shortcuts:
--passwordforces the email + password path,--provider google|githubforces a browser path. - Piped input skips the menu and goes straight to email + password, so existing
automation keeps working:
printf 'email\npassword\n' | npx sqemo-mcp login - The browser paths need a browser on the same machine (the callback returns to
127.0.0.1). Over SSH or in CI, use--passwordor theSQEMO_EMAIL/SQEMO_PASSWORDenvironment variables.

Live database (2 tools)
Read-only against your own database. Both query only the information schema — never table data — and the connection URL is used by this local process only, never sent to Sqemo servers.
| Tool | Description |
|---|---|
introspect_db | Import a live PostgreSQL/MySQL schema into an existing ERD (Pro) |
check_db_drift | Check a live database or a schema dump against the ERD's physical model — missing/extra tables and columns, PK/FK/NOT NULL mismatches (Pro) |

Cloud writes require owner or shared-editor permission and are protected by version CAS with 3-way auto-merge for concurrent edits.
CLI for CI pipelines
Offline, file-based subcommands (no login needed):
# Naming-standard check — exits 1 on violations, great as a CI gate
npx sqemo-mcp lint schema.erd.json
# Schema export to stdout
npx sqemo-mcp export schema.erd.json --format sql --dialect postgres > schema.sql
npx sqemo-mcp export schema.erd.json --format dbml > schema.dbml
Drift mode compares the model against a real database or a dump, and exits 1 when they disagree (Pro, requires login):
npx sqemo-mcp lint schema.erd.json --db "$DATABASE_URL" [--db-schema public] [--strict]
npx sqemo-mcp lint schema.erd.json --schema dump.sql --dialect postgres
npx sqemo-mcp lint --erd <cloud-erd-id> --db "$DATABASE_URL" --ignore 'tmp_*'

Environment variables
| Variable | Purpose |
|---|---|
SQEMO_EMAIL / SQEMO_PASSWORD | Non-interactive login for CI and SSH sessions (no browser needed) |
ERDMAKER_HOME | Override the credentials directory (default ~/.erdmaker) |
ERDMAKER_SUPABASE_URL | Override the API URL (defaults to the Sqemo cloud) |
ERDMAKER_SUPABASE_ANON_KEY | Override the API publishable key |
ERDMAKER_MAX_REQUESTS_PER_MINUTE | Per-minute request cap (default 120, 0 disables) |
ERDMAKER_MAX_REQUESTS_PER_DAY | Daily request cap (default 10000, 0 disables) |
The request caps are a safety net against agents stuck in loops; exceeding them
returns a rate_limited error that tells the agent to stop and notify the user.
Errors
All tool errors return { code, message } — e.g. not_authenticated, no_permission,
save_conflict (retry after re-reading), validation_failed, rate_limited.
